EN - BEFORE STARTING:
Observe all of the local hydraulic and building regulations.
The following instructions are to be followed by qualified personnel with the technical
background and experience needed to manage the product safely.
This shower tray should only be used in domestic environments at room temperature.
The Manufacturer shall not be held responsible and the warranty shall no longer be
valid in case of improper use..
Open the package and inspect the shower tray for damage.
Before installing the product, use a metallic bar or ruler to make sure the
product has not warped due to improper storage. In case of improper installation,
warranty will decay. In case of installation of a warped/deformed product, warranty
will decay. A 2 mm distortion per linear metre is within the tolerances of manufacture
and is therefore not to be considered a defect. Place the shower tray back in the carton
until it is nstalled.
Before installing, check access to the final hydraulic connections.
To prevent water stagnation, the shower jet must fall entirely and exactly within the
shower tray, preferably above the drain (and never above the flat standing/walk-in
area). Warranty will decay in case of improper installation.
PREPARING THE LOCATION:
Make sure the floor and the supporting surfaces are flat, level and stable. Drill a hole
that is wide enough to contain the appropriate drainage kit needed for the drainage
system. The hole must be appropriately located and while keeping the position and
size of the shower tray in mind.
PREPARING THE SHOWER TRAY:
Install the drainage kit on the shower tray as indicated by the Manufacturer. Position
the shower tray where it shall be installed (raised by means of wooden blocks), make
sure it is plumb and level and fasten all the hydraulic connections of the drainage
system.
Open the faucets and let the water run inside the shower tray. Check all the
connections for possible leaks.
Place the shower tray on the oor and make sure it is perfectly at. Seal the entire
perimeter of the shower tray with acetic silicone. If the shower tray is slightly above
the floor, or semi-embedded, leave 2-3 mm of space around the entire perimeter
(which must be sealed with acetic silicone); as to make room for the thermal
expansion of the material.
Let the silicone dry for at least 24 hours before using the shower tray (or before
mounting any shower walls).
Protect the surface of the shower tray from mortar, glue or putty used to install the
shower cubicle, tiles or for any other installation.
INSTRUCTIONS FOR USE:
This shower tray cannot be used autonomously by people with reduced
motor skills, or with sensory and/or cognitive impairments (including
children), or by anyone lacking the necessary know-how needed.
This shower tray was designed for domestic use, or similar, and it must only
be installed and used at room temperature.
It is dangerous to use the shower tray in the vicinity or while using electrical
appliances (radios, hair dryers, electric heaters etc.).
When the surface of the shower tray is wet, the degree of slipperiness
increases, especially if shampoos, soaps and oils are used. This shower tray
could be slippery during its use.
CARE AND MAINTENANCE:
Taking care of this product is simple and quick. For everyday cleaning, use soapy
water or a creamy detergent and a cloth or soft sponge. Common everyday bathroom
products in spray, liquid, gel or cream forms are acceptable.
Rinse well and clean regularly after use to prevent the accumulation of dirt or
limescale.
For extraordinary cleaning, a limescale remover such as Viakal, white wine vinegar or
lemon juice can be used, taking care to rinse the surface well.
HOW TO PREVENT DAMAGES:
The surface is very resistant to stains in general: we do not recommend the use of
very aggressive products such as acetone, trichloroethylene, strong acids (muriatic
acid) or strong bases (caustic soda), industrial detergents or solvents used in the paint
sector. Some substances, such as ink, cosmetics and dyes, if in prolonged contact with
the surface, can stain the material; the same can happen with lighted cigarettes. Do
not use metal scrapers, iron brushes, blades, cutters or other domestic metal tools to
remove stains, paint, putty or anything else. Avoid hitting or objects falling on the
tray.
Avoid any thermal stress: do not use boiling water (exceeding 55°C – 130°F) and do
not pour boiling liquids or oils on the surface. Do not put red-hot objects, cigarettes or
ames onto the surface. Do not direct hot steam onto the surface to clean it.
REMEDIES FOR INCIDENTALLY OCCURRED DAMAGES:
If your installer or bricklayer has dirtied the product while installing it, this can
be cleaned with a buffering acid (e.g. Mapei Keranet liquid) and a soft sponge to
eliminate any residues, taking care to test it in a hidden area rst.
To remove stains, haloes, burns and light scratches, use a common cream detergent
(e.g. Cif) with a wet Scotch-Brite pad. If this is not enough, use P400 ne abrasive
paper, paying attention not to ruin the texture.
PRODUCT GUARANTEE:
All products purchased by consumers, as defined in Article 3 of the Consumer Code
(Legislative Decree no. 206 of 6 September 2005 and subsequent amendments),
are covered by the legal guarantee of the seller under Article 128 and subsequent
amendments of the consumer Code. In case of lack of conformity of the product, we
invite the consumer to contact their dealer within the statutory deadline.
The WARRANTY is valid whenever:
Installation was performed appropriately, with walls, shower tray, well-aligned walls
and leveled floors.
The product was checked before installation.
The installation, as made, was checked to make sure there were no water leaks and
the water drained away properly.
Product maintenance and cleaning are carried out according to the instructions
reported in the Cure and Maintenance Manual.
The WARRANTY is not valid whenever:
The instructions for use and installation reported herein were not observed.
A warped or faulty product has been installed without the mandatory prior inspection.
The Installer/User changed or customized the product without the manufacturer's
authorization.
Accidental damages occur as a result of collisions or improper use. The wear and tear
of the product occurs normally.
Damages are caused by disasters, such as fires or natural disasters, including floods,
earthquakes, etc.
